body {
	font-size : 12px;
	color : #000000;
	font-family :"宋体",Arial, Helvetica, sans-serif;
	text-align : center;
	margin : 0;
	background: url(Default/fuzi2_bg.gif) repeat-y center;
}
a {text-decoration : none;color : #000000; } 
a:hover {text-decoration : underline; color : #4455aa; } 
td {font-family : "宋体",Arial, Helvetica, sans-serif; font-size : 12px;line-height : normal;} 
th {
	background: url(Default/banner2_bg.jpg); 
	color : #000000; 
	font-size : 12px; 
	font-weight : bold; 
	line-height: normal; 
	} 
th a {color : #000000; text-decoration : none; } 
th a:hover {color : #01509D;text-decoration : underline;} 
input , select , textarea , option {font-family : "宋体",Arial, Helvetica, sans-serif; font-size : 12px; color : #000000;line-height:18px;} 
hr {
	height:0px;
	width : 100%;
	border-top: 1px solid #BB2D00;
} 
/*深蓝色按钮样式*/
.button-bg {
	height: 21px;
	width: 62px;
	color: #000000;
	margin-right: 5px;
	border:0;
	background: url(Default/button2_bg5_13.gif) no-repeat;
}
/*弹出表情层样式*/
.biaoq{width:380px;float:left;}
.biaoq_top {
	width: 100%;
	height: 11px;
	float: left;
	background: url(Default/biaoq2_top.gif) no-repeat left bottom;
}
.biaoq_main {
	float: left;
	background-color: #FFE7E3;
	width: 378px;
	padding:10px 0;
	text-align:center;
	border-right: 1px solid #BB2D00;
	border-bottom: 1px solid #BB2D00;
	border-left: 1px solid #BB2D00;
}
/*首页登录按钮样式*/
.button_login {
	height: 21px;
	width: 48px;
	color: #000000;
	margin-right: 5px;
	border:0;
	background: url(Default/button2_bg1.gif) no-repeat;
}

/*翻页相关*/
.PageInput{
	border : 1px solid #d6e0ef;
	background-color : #fafafa;
	height : 18px;
	line-height:18px;
	font-family : "宋体",Arial, Helvetica, sans-serif;
	font-size : 11.5px;
	width: 18px;
	} 
.PageInput1{
	border : 1px solid #d6e0ef;
	background-color : #fafafa;
	height : 15px;
	line-height:15px;
	font-family : "宋体",Arial, Helvetica, sans-serif;
	font-size : 11.5px;
	} 
.tabletitle1 {background-color :#FFE7E5; color :#000;} 
.tabletitle2 {background-color : #F6C5BE; } 
.tablebody1 {background-color : #fff; line-height : normal; } 
.tablebody2 {background-color : #FFE7E5; line-height : normal; } 
.tablebody3 {background-color : #BB2D00; } 
.tableborder1 {width : 98%; border:1px none inherit; background-color : #BB2D00;}
.tableborder2 {width : 98%; border : 1px solid #dedede; background-color : #efefef; margin:0 auto;} 
.tableborder3 {
	width : 98%; 
	border-left : 1px solid #BB2D00; 
	border-right : 1px solid #BB2D00; 
	border-top : 0px none inherit;
	border-bottom : 0 solid #BB2D00; 
	background-color : #efefef; 
	} 
.tableborder4 {width : 98%; border : 1px solid #BB2D00;} 
.tableborder5 {	background-color : #BC2E00;} 
.tableborder6 {width : 98%; border : 0 none inherit;background-color : #fff;} 
.tableborder7 {width : 98%; border:1px none inherit; background-color : #BB2D00;} 
.singleborder {font-size : 0px;line-height : 1px;padding : 0px;background-color : #BB2D00;} 
#nobold {font-weight : normal;} 
.normaltextSmall {font-size : 11px; color : #000000;font-family :"宋体", verdana, Arial, Helvetica, sans-serif, fantasy;} 
.menuskin {border : 1px solid #666666; visibility : hidden; font-size : 12px;position : absolute;background-color : #efefef; background-image : url(Default/dvmenubg3.gif); background-repeat : repeat-y;} 
.menuskin a {padding-right : 10px;padding-left : 25px; color : black;text-decoration : none;} 
.menuitems {margin : 2px; padding : 1px; text-align : left; line-height : 14pt; } 
.brightClass {background-color : #d7d7d7; } 
.redfont {color : red;} 
.bluefont {color : #BB2D00;} 
.imgonclick {cursor : pointer;} 
.menu_popup {display : none; } 
.itableborder {
	width : 98%;
	line-height : 30px;
	height: 30px;
	text-align: center;
	margin: 0 auto;
} 
.itableborder1 {
	width : 100%;
	margin: 0 auto;
	text-align: left;
	line-height: 25px;
	background-color: #EEEDEB;
	text-indent: 10px;
	height: 25px;
	} 
#notice {
	line-height: 25px;
	background-color: #E4E9EF;
	text-align: left;
	text-indent: 10px;
	height: 25px;
	width: 100%;}
/*内容部分渐变背景样式*/
#main_bg {
	width: 100%;
	vertical-align: top;
	background: url(Default/fuzi2_bg.gif) repeat-y center top;
}
#top_bar li {
	list-style-type: none;
	color: #fff;
	height: 25px;
	width: 85px;
	margin-left: 5px;
	display: inline;
	float: right;
	background: url(Default/button2_bg2.gif) no-repeat;
}
#top_bar {float: right;}
#top_bar a {color: #000000;text-align: center;display: block;line-height: 25px;height: 25px;text-decoration: none;}
/*底部图案背景样式*/
/*输入框样式*/
.input_frame {border: 1px solid #F6C5BE;height: 15px;background-color: #F9EEEC;line-height: 15px;}
div.quote {margin : 5px 20px; border : 1px solid #cccccc; padding : 5px;background : #f3f3f3; line-height : normal;} 
div.htmlcode {
	margin : 5px 20px; 
	border : 1px solid #cccccc;
	padding : 5px;
	background : #fdfddf;
	font-size : 14px; 
	font-family : "宋体",Arial, Helvetica, sans-serif;
	font-style : oblique;
	line-height : normal;
	font-weight : bold;
	} 
div.info {border-top : 1px dotted #cccccc; padding : 5px;line-height : normal; color : #c5c5c5;} 
font.showtools {color : white; background-color : #b88ffc; } 
.magicframe {border : 1px solid #cccccc; } 

.copyright {color : #cccccc; line-height : 130%; } 
#tdleft {
	float:left;
	padding-top: 10px;
	width: 49%;
	padding-left: 10px;
}
#tdright{
	float:left;
	vertical-align: top;
	padding-top: 10px;
	width: 49%;
}
.mainbar1{width : 98%;min-width :760px;margin: 0 auto;line-height: 25px;height: 25px;background-position: top;}
.mainbar{
	width : 98%;
	min-width :760px;
	line-height:22px;
	margin: 0 auto;
	background-color: #FFFFFF;
	border-right: 1px solid #BB2D00;
	border-left: 1px solid #BB2D00;
}
.mainbar6{
	width : 98%;
	min-width :760px;
	line-height:22px;
	margin: 0 auto;
	background-color: #FFFFFF;
}
.mainbar0{width : 98%;min-width :760px;margin : 0 auto;line-height:22px;}
.mainbar2{
	width : 98%;
	min-width :760px;
	margin : 0 auto;
	line-height:22px;
	background-color: #F6C5BE;
	border-right: 1px solid #BB2D00;
	border-left: 1px solid #BB2D00;
	border-bottom: 1px solid #BB2D00;
}
.mainbar3{
	width : 98%;
	min-width :760px;
	margin : 0 auto;
	background-color : #fff;
	border-right: 1px solid #BB2D00;
	border-bottom: 1px solid #BB2D00;
	border-left: 1px solid #BB2D00;
}
.mainbar4{
	border-left : 1px solid #BB2D00; 
	border-right : 1px solid #BB2D00;
	border-top : 1px solid #BB2D00; 
	width : 98%;
	min-width :760px;
	margin : 0 auto;
	background-color : #fff;
	height:25px;
	line-height:25px;
	}
.mainbar5{width : 98%;min-width :760px;line-height:22px;margin-top: 0 auto;}
.index_left_states{
	width :46px;
	float:left;
	height:60px;
	background-color : #fff;
	border-right: 1px solid #BB2E01;
}
.index_right{float:right;width :240px;text-align : left; line-height:25px;}
.index_left_states img{margin-top:28px;}
.boardlogo{float:right;margin-top:4px;margin-right:5px;border:0px;}
#topbar_top{background-image : url(Default/css/default/topbg.gif); height:9px;line-height:9px;font-size : 0px;color : #BB2D00;}
/*顶部样式*/
#topbar_mid{
	height:117px;
	text-align : left;
	width: 100%;
	background-color: #fff;
	background: url(../images/logo2_bg.jpg) no-repeat left top;
}
#topbar_bottom{background-image : url(Default/css/default/bottombg.gif);height:9px;line-height:9px;font-size : 0px;color : #BB2D00;}
#topbar_menu{background-image : url(Default/css/default/tabs_m_tile.gif); height:22px;line-height:22px;text-align : left;}
/*logo位置样式*/
#topbar_mid_l{float:left;min-width:205px;}
/*顶部用户信息处样式*/
#topbar_mid_m{
	width:45%;
	float:right;
	margin-top:90px;
	min-width:468px;
	height: 27px;
	color: #F8F7DB;
	text-align: right;
}
#topbar_mid_m a{color:#fff;}
#topbar_mid_r{float:right;margin-top:5px;min-width:90px;line-height:15pt;text-align :right;margin-right:5px;}
.menudiv1{float:left;margin-left:2px;height:26px;line-height:27px;text-indent:8px;margin-top: 1px;}
.menudiv2{float:left;margin-left:25px;height:26px;line-height:26px;margin-top: 2px;}
/*标题栏*/
.th,.th1{
	width : 98%;
	min-width :760px;
	text-align : left;
	margin : 0 auto;
	color : #000000;
	font-size : 12px;
	font-weight : bold;
	height: 26px;
	line-height: 26px;
	background: url(Default/banner2_bg.jpg) repeat-x left top;
	border-top: 1px solid #BB2D00;
	border-right: 1px solid #BB2D00;
	border-left: 1px solid #BB2D00;
}
div.th div,div.th1 div{text-align : center;vertical-align: middle;}
div.th a ,div.th1 a{color : #000;text-decoration : none;line-height: 26px;height: 26px;} 
div.th a:hover,div.th1 a:hover {color : #01509D;text-decoration : underline; }
div.th img,div.th1 img{vertical-align: middle;margin-right: 2px;margin-left: 2px;}
.img_center{vertical-align: bottom;}
.bottomline{height :24px;line-height :24px;border-bottom : 1px solid #BB2D00;float:left;}
#rules{border-bottom : 1px solid #BB2D00;text-align : left; line-height : 15px; }
#rulesbody{text-indent:24px;padding:10px;}
.list_bg{
	height:26px;
	line-height:26px;
	width:98%;
	margin:0 auto;
	background-color: #FFE7E3;
	border-right: 1px solid #BB2D00;
	border-left: 1px solid #BB2D00;
}
.list1{float:left;width:32px;}
.list_r{float:right;width:400px; }
.list{
	width : 98%;
	min-width :760px;
	height:31px;
	line-height:31px;
	text-align : left;
	overflow :hidden;
	margin: 0 auto;
	background: url(Default/list2_bg.gif) repeat-x top;
	border-right: 1px solid #BB2D00;
	border-left:  1px solid #BB2D00;
	border-bottom:  1px solid #BB2D00;
}
.list div{height:26px;}
.list_s{float:left;text-align : center;width:32px; }
.list_s img{line-height: 31px;margin-top: 8px;}
.list_a{float:left;text-align : center;width:80px; overflow :hidden;}
.list_c{float:left;text-align : center;width:50px; overflow :hidden;}
.list_t{float:left;text-align : center;width:120px;margin-left:5px;overflow :hidden;}
.list_r1{float:right;width:400px;}
.list_img{float:left;text-align : center;}
.list_img img{margin-left:2px;margin-top:8px;margin-right:8px;border:0px;}
form{margin:0px;}
/*发表主题样式*/
#posttopic{
	width:85px;
	height:25px;
	float:left;
	margin : 2px;
	cursor:pointer;
	line-height: 25px;
	color: #000000;
	text-indent: 15px;
	background: url(Default/button2_bg2.gif) no-repeat top;
}
/*发表投票按钮样式*/
#postvote{
	width:85px;
	height:25px;
	float:left;
	margin : 2px;
	cursor:pointer;
	line-height: 25px;
	color: #000000;
	text-indent: 15px;
	background: url(Default/button2_bg2.gif) no-repeat top;
}
/*小字报按钮样式*/
#postpaper{
	width:85px;
	height:25px;
	float:left;
	margin : 2px;
	cursor:pointer;
	line-height: 25px;
	color: #000000;
	text-align: center;
	text-indent: 15px;
	background: url(Default/button2_bg2.gif) no-repeat top;
}
/*回复帖子*/
#repost{
	width:85px;
	height:26px;
	float:left;
	margin : 2px;
	cursor:pointer;
	color: #000000;
	text-indent: 15px;
	line-height: 26px;
	background: url(Default/button2_bg2.gif) no-repeat center;
}
#postalipay{width:85px;height:26px;float:left;background-image : url(Default/alipay.gif); margin : 2px;cursor:pointer;}
.main{width : 98%;min-width :760px;margin : 0 auto;}
#boardmaster{margin-top:2px;text-align : left;}
#boardmaster a{margin-right:2px;}
#masterpic{
	float:left;
	width:34px;
	height:26px;
	background-image: url(Default/icon2_dl.jpg);
	background-repeat: no-repeat;
	background-position: center;
}
#boardmanage{float:right;margin-right:2px;}
#subject{text-align :left;}
#subject img{margin-top:5px;}
.listexpression{margin-left:2px;margin-top:2px;margin-right:8px;float:left;}
.filetype{margin-top:5px;margin-right:8px;float:left;}
.listtitle{float:left;}
.listtitle div{float:left;}
.listtitle img{margin-top:5px;margin-right:8px;float:left;}
.postlary1{
	width : 98%;
	min-width :760px;
	margin : 0 auto;
	background-color:#FFE7E3;
	text-align : left;
	border-right: 1px solid #BB2D00;
	border-left: 1px solid #BB2D00;
}
/* 内容页中边框样式*/
.postlary2{
	border-top: 1px solid #BB2D00;
}
.postlary3{
	border-bottom: 1px solid #BB2D00;
}
.postuserinfo{
	float:left;
	width:190px;
	text-align: center;
}
.post{border-left: 1px solid #91C7ED;margin-left : 190px;min-height:300px;padding:10px;}
.postie{
margin-left:190px;
height:300px;
padding:10px;
background-color: #FFFFFF;
border-top: 1px solid #E4F5FF;
}
/*清除浮动*/
.qc_clear{clear: both;}
/*帖子快捷回复及显示时间的样式*/
.postie1{
	height:30px;
	line-height:30px;
	background-color: #FFFFFF;
	margin-left:190px!important; 
	margin-left:193px;
	border-top: 1px solid #FFE7E3;
}
.bbs_operate{float:right;margin-right:5px;margin-bottom:5px;}
.postbottom1{
	width:98%;
	min-width :760px;
	background-color:#FFE7E3;
	text-align : left;
	margin: 0 auto;
	border-right: 1px solid #BB2D00;
	border-left: 1px solid #BB2D00;
}
.postbottom2{
	width : 98%;
	min-width :760px;
	margin : 0 auto;
	height:28px;
	line-height:28px;
	background-color : #F6C5BE;
	border-left: 1px solid #BB2D00;
	border-right: 1px solid #BB2D00;
	text-align : left; 
	}
.postbottom3{
	width:98%;
	min-width :760px;
	background-color:#FFE7E3;
	text-align : left;
	margin: 0 auto;
	border-right: 1px solid #BB2D00;
	border-bottom: 1px solid #BB2D00;
	border-left: 1px solid #BB2D00;
}
#postend{border-bottom : 1px solid #BB2D00;}
.lockuser{
	height:30px;
	line-height:30px;
	width:150px;
	border: 1px solid #BB2D00;
	border-top:3px double #BB2D00;
	text-align : center;
	color:#00008B;
	margin :240px 0px 0px 10px;
	background-color : #F6C5BE;
	float:right;
	}
.vote{float:left;border-left: 1px solid #BB2D00;height:28px;}
.li1{border-left : 1px solid #BB2D00; 
line-height : 28px;height : 28px;}
.li2{border-left : 1px solid #BB2D00; line-height : 28px;height : 28px;background-color : #F6C5BE;}
DIV DIV.PostTitle
{
	word-wrap:break-word;
	word-break:break-all;
	width:600;
	text-align: left;
}
/*内容页面中论坛显示楼层信息处样式*/
.bbs_information{
	height:25px;
	line-height:25px;
	margin-bottom:10px;
	border-bottom: 1px solid #FFE7E3;
}
/*banner左边的图标样式*/
.icon_bg {
	background: url(Default/icon2_dl.jpg) no-repeat left top;
	float: left;
	height: 26px;
	width: 34px;
	margin: 0px;
}
.icon_bg1 {
	background-image: url(Default/nofollow.gif);
	background-repeat: no-repeat;
	float: left;
	height: 26px;
	width: 20px;
	margin: 0px;
	background-position: center;
}
/*列表页面中主题栏*/
.list_1{
	height:26px;
	line-height:26px;
	}
.list_1 img{
	margin-top:5px;}
/*版本导读右侧展开及收起*/
.expand{
	float:right;
	margin-right:8px;
	width:12px;
	text-indent:5px;
	font-size: 15px;
	font-weight: bold;
}
/*内容页面中快速回复标题栏样式*/
.reply_bt{
    width:100%;
	height:30px;
	line-height:30px;
	text-indent:10px;
	border-bottom: 1px solid #BB2D00;}
/*用户登录后会员信息样式*/
#bbs_login{
    float:left;
	text-align:left;
	}
#bbs_login div{
    height:20px;
	line-height:20px;
	}

